深入学习ASP.NET编程指南

需积分: 9 7 下载量 114 浏览量 更新于2024-10-26 收藏 6.13MB PDF 举报
"ASP.NET深入编程" 本书是一本针对ASP.NET技术的深度教程,旨在帮助初学者和有一定经验的开发者更好地理解和应用这一微软的网络开发工具。作者通过丰富的实例和详尽的讲解,使得复杂的概念变得易于理解。这本书特别适合初级和中级读者,同时也可供高级用户和高等院校相关专业的师生作为参考。 全书共分为15章,覆盖了从基础到高级的ASP.NET编程各个方面。以下是各章的主要内容概览: 1. ASP.NET的发展战略和发展概况:介绍ASP.NET的技术背景和未来趋势,为读者构建宏观认知。 2. 环境与Visual Studio .NET:指导读者安装.NET Framework和Visual Studio .NET,以及如何使用该集成开发环境进行开发。 3. ASP.NET的语言基础:重点讲解C#语言语法,为后续的Web开发奠定基础。 4. WebForm页面:阐述WebForm的概念,以及如何创建和使用,通过实例帮助读者掌握WebForm的运用。 5. ASP.NET的验证:介绍多种验证技术,确保用户输入数据的安全性和准确性。 6. 服务器端控件:讲解服务器控件的功能和使用方法,提升Web应用的交互性。 7. 自定义与HTML控件:涵盖自定义控件的创建和HTML控件的使用,帮助读者深入理解ASP.NET的自定义功能。 8. ASP.NET的数据库编程:详细阐述ADO.NET,包括数据库连接、操作和数据绑定技术,实现与数据库的高效交互。 9. 应用程序:讲解.config文件配置和全局.asax的应用,通过“会员系统”实例深入探讨应用程序的架构和管理。 10. WebService:介绍WebService的基本原理,以及如何通过实例进行数据交换和站点对象的访问。 11. 性能优化:探讨输出缓冲和数据缓冲技术,提升ASP.NET应用的性能。 12. 高级应用:涉及XML在ASP.NET中的应用、三层架构的设计和实现,以及微软消息队列(MSMQ)的使用。 13. ASP.NET实战:提供大量实战例子,涵盖多种应用场景和技巧,提升解决实际问题的能力。 14. 延伸:向Windows编程扩展,展示如何将ASP.NET技术与其他平台相结合。 15. 网上资源:推荐有价值的ASP.NET相关网络资源,便于读者进一步学习和交流。 通过这本书,读者不仅可以系统地学习ASP.NET的各个层面,还能积累丰富的实践经验,提升自己的编程技能。书中的实例丰富、讲解细致,使得学习过程更具成效。无论是对于个人提升还是教学使用,都是一本非常实用的参考资料。